5. Operating Principle
The immersion probe comprises a measuring cell, two-wire transmitter and
special cable with capillary tube. The housing is made out of stainless steel with a
pressure-sensitive diaphragm that is protected with a plastic cap. The level signal
is determined by the pressure difference between the water column over the
probe and atmospheric pressure which is transferred to the probe through the
capillary tube. This differential pressure is converted to a 4 to 20 mA analogue
signal by the piezo-resistive cell and the fitted electronics.

6. Mechanical Connection
The immersion probe is immersed up to the deepest point into the well or the
basin. This is because only the water column above the sensor is measured.
The probe may not fall onto the water surface, but must be immersed
carefully, since otherwise the membrane will be destroyed.
Fasten the cable in such a way, so that the probe hangs freely and the
capillary and supply pipe are not squeezed together. To anchor it properly, wind
the tube three to four times around a pipe having a diameter from 50 to 100 mm
and fix the cable-ends with a cable-strap. The cable end should be prepared
according to the following diagram.
Moisture must not be allowed to enter the capillary.

An over-voltage protection (NTB-OVP) should be used with the outdoorinstallation. The grounding of the over-voltage protection must be connected to
the protective grounding via the shortest path available. Please observe the
relevant regulations and safety standards (VDI/VDE).
If the conductor length in the open field is larger than 15 m (outdoors) between
transducer and evaluation electronics, an additional over-voltage protection
needs to be employed.

8. Maintenance
In case the medium to be measured is not contaminated, NTB units are
maintenance-free. If the dirt forms on membrane and needs to be cleaned, make
sure you do not use any hard cleaning agents. If damaged, repair of membrane is
possible only by the manufacturer.
